Kolkata, Nov 6 (IANS) Debutant pacer Mohammed Shami picked up four for 71 as India bowled out the West Indies for 234 in the first innings shortly after tea on the first day of the first cricket Test at the Eden Gardens here Wednesday.

Marlon Samuels was the top scorer with 65 while Shivnarine Chanderpaul made 36.

Besides Shami, offie Ravichandran Ashwin bagged two for 52 while Bhuvneshwar Kumar got one for 33.
